Even without childhood memories, Pure Fiji's body butter is a therapeutic spa-like experience. Rich and emollient, this is not a moisturiser you can slap on and run as it takes awhile to sink into your skin - giving you an excuse to take a break and indulge yourself. If you have dry skin, you're in for a treat. This cream is packed with natural goodies to soften and moisturise. Nut oils to hydrate and lock in moisture, milk proteins to firm and reduce the appearance of fine-lines, and soy & passionflower to sooth and calm.

In the jar, this cream is quite solid and I found a little went a long way. A dab, warmed between the palms of my hands, emulsified and glided easily over my entire leg. It feels initially greasy and slightly sticky, which may be off-putting to some but those who enjoy using body oils will appreciate the feeling of intense hydration. Massaging this cream into the skin helps it sink in more quickly.

The first time I used this cream after my nightly shower, I woke up to silky soft, perfectly moisturised skin. The slight flakiness on my legs has completely disappeared and they now have the slight sheen of well-hydrated skin. The fragrance, while initially quite strong, faded quickly and disappeared by morning so it didn't interfere with my perfume. There was no need to moisturise again during the day and a weekend of use has left me with touchably soft skin.

The Pure Fiji range of body products is based on the natural remedies Pacific Islanders use to moisturise and protect their skins from the elements. The body butter retails at £18.95 and is available online and at selected spas and retailers.
